Committee advances bill to raise major‑party registration threshold from 5% to 10% (HB 3908)

House Bill 3908, which would raise the percentage of registered voters required for a party to be treated as a major political party in Oregon from 5% to 10% and take effect July 1, 2025, received a committee recommendation to move to the floor with a new‑pass report.
